People of Joura Kalan demands up-gradation of GGMS to High School
6/24/2018 10:45:11 PM
Early Times Report
Doda, June 24: The poor public of village Joura Kalan in Tehsil Kahara of District Doda has been facing discrimination in education sector as the lone Government Girls School Joura Kalan opened in the area about 50 years back, has not seen the attention of education authorities in terms of Up-gradation. Other similar Institutions opened in the area, namely in village Kencha, Joura Khurd, Tanta, Kahara, Nandana, Dadi Kathava etc, have been upgraded to Hr. Secondary Schools or High Schools but Government Girls School Joura Kalan has hardly been granted Middle School few years back despite the fact that there is huge strength of girl students available and more to this, there are 4 middle schools, (Middle School Kunthal, Middle School Suranga, Middle School, Budhi & Middle School Shamdlian) around Govt. Girl Middle School Joura Kalan, which can become the feeding schools in case the present Govt. Girls Middle School Joura Kalan is up-graded to Girls High School. In absence of this, the poor girls have to travel a distance of 4 to 5 kms on foot for higher education. Mostly, because of this handicap, the dropout percentage of girls has increased manifold. As per release issued here by the President Thathri Development Front, District Doda Kuldeep Kumar Rao said that there is strong resentment against the successive Governments and the authorities for this neglect & step motherly treatment.
